Trenton Thunder Game Recap 4/22

Bases-Clearing Triple Clutch in 4-3 Win

Dan Fiorito's three-run triple in the bottom of the eighth inning boosted the Thunder to a 4-3 victory over the RubberDucks on Tuesday night at ARM & HAMMER Park.
Trailing 3-1, the Thunder loaded the bases with one out against reliever Francisco Valera. Shawn Armstrong entered and struck out Yeral Sanchez before Fiorito lined an 0-1 offering into the right field corner to score all three baserunners.
Brandon Pinder earned the victory with two scoreless innings of relief, including two strikeouts.
Bryan Mitchell took a no-decision in his return to the Thunder rotation, allowing just one run on four hits and one walk over five innings; he struck out six. RubberDuck starter Joe Colon also earned a no-decision despite allowing just one run over six innings.
Akron broke a 1-1 tie in the sixth inning with a solo home run off the bat of Giovanny Urshela. In the seventh, Francisco Lindor singled home Tyler Naquin with two out to take a 3-1 lead.
The Thunder managed double digit hits for the fourth straight contest. Ben Gamel, Rob Segedin and Rob Refsnyder each had two hits in the game. Gamel improved his on-base streak to 17 straight games with a first inning walk.
